UTME 2019: JAMB Top Scorer Gets $40,000 Scholarship

A private university in Accra, Ghana, ACADEMIC has offered scholarship worth $40,000 to  JAMB Top Scorer, Ekene Franklin Ezeunala. Ekene Franklin Ezeunala scored the highest score in the 2019 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ME).
